  • 650 BCE

    Citizens

    Only citizens could vote.Only men who had completed their military training were counted as citizens.

  • 530 BCE

    Pythagoras' beliefs

    Pythagoras believed that mathematics is the basis for everthing. Pythagoras believed that the world depends upon the interaction of opposites such as male and female, lightness and darkness...
  • 528 BCE

    The theorem of Pythagoras

    The longest side of the triangle is called the "hypotenuse",so the formal definitive is:In a right triangle:The square of the hypotenuse is equal to the sum of the squares of the other two side.
